OK, I don't get it. I've tried a couple of games (Worms Armageddon, Zeus), they install easily, but when I load them everything on the screen is upside down. And sometimes mirrored as well? Any ideas what the cause of this could be?

I've got a T-bird 1.3GHz and a MSI Geforce 2 Pro (Starforce 831). I've got the latest authorized nVidia and 4-in-1 drivers as well.

Theres no problems at all in ordinary applications (Office, Dreamweaver, Acrobat, etc.)

Try to verify that the correct monitor is selected, and it is using the correct refresh rates for all resolutions. The upside down and mirroring is a lot of times caused by overdriving a lower resolution like 800x600. Some resolution that you don't use and haven't configured correctly yet.
